Criminal Justice Wages Near Mankato

Mankato is part of the Mankato, MN metro area (BLS area code 31860).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Minnesota stat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Attorney$126,450Mankato, MN$138,956
Judge or Magistrate$182,790MN statewide$200,868
Police Supervisor$97,870Mankato, MN$107,549
Detective or Criminal Investigator$82,330MN statewide$90,473
Police or Sheriff’s Patrol Officer$82,370Mankato, MN$90,516
Correctional Officer$64,670MN statewide$71,066
Probation Officer$79,510MN statewide$87,374
Forensic Science Technician$68,790MN statewide$75,593
Paralegal or Legal Assistant$61,950Mankato, MN$68,077
Information Security Analyst$128,830MN statewide$141,571

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

How do I verify a program is accredited?

Confirm institutional accreditation via the U.S. Department of Education database (U.S. Dept. of Education database), and check for any program-specific accreditation listed by the school.
